Job description
Overview

We're recruiting for a Field Operations Manager to drive compliance within the designated portfolio of our Asylum Accommodation and Support Services Contract (AASC). We focus on providing a high standard of accommodation for the service users we house through a combination of both reactive and planned maintenance, completed by our team of multi skilled maintenance operatives and approved contractors.

Responsibilities
  • Provide clear management to Maintenance Operatives and Housing Officers in their provision of property maintenance services and service user support services, and accountability to the Head of Field Operations for all property maintenance services and any service user support services within the respective region.
  • Provide leadership and strategic direction to the Housing Officers and Maintenance Operatives within their allocated portfolio; work with other Management Team members to deliver outstanding and effective service.
  • Ensure compliance with the AASC contract, company policies, processes and procedures for designated area of responsibility, through management of staff and liaising with other teams within the business, landlords, sub-contractors, external agencies and partners.
  • Ensure all properties within their allocated area are safe, habitable, fit for purpose and fully equipped in accordance with contract standards both national and local, while also ensuring regulatory and legislative requirements are met.
  • Ensure provision of service user dispersal, relocation, ongoing support services and discontinuation activities within their designated portfolio is delivered in accordance with the contract and that all service users maintain compliance with the conditions of their support provision.
What you\'ll need to do the role

First and foremost, you will have proven people management skills and the ability to analyse data and produce accurate timely reports. A background in managing multi skilled maintenance operatives, delivering against key performance indicators, working to tight deadlines and within set budgets, would also be beneficial.
